Understanding the Core Gameplay Loop

At its essence, the gameplay of a typical chickenroad experience revolves around precision timing and pattern recognition. Players control the chicken, usually with simple tap or click controls, allowing them to move forward a fixed distance with each input. The road is populated by a constant stream of vehicles traveling at increasing speeds, and the challenge lies in identifying gaps in the traffic and timing the chicken’s movements to safely navigate through them. Success is measured by the number of lanes crossed, with each successful crossing awarding points. A single collision with a vehicle results in an immediate game over, requiring the player to start anew.

The appeal of this gameplay loop lies in its accessibility and inherent tension. Anyone can pick up the game and immediately understand the mechanics, but achieving a high score requires developing a keen sense of timing and the ability to anticipate traffic patterns. The constant threat of failure adds a layer of excitement, as players are perpetually on the edge of their seats, carefully analyzing the road ahead and strategizing their next move. The addictive nature of these games stems from the “just one more try” mentality, as players strive to beat their previous high scores and conquer the ever-increasing difficulty.

Strategies for Maximizing Your Score

While luck certainly plays a role, there are several strategies players can employ to improve their chances of success. Observing the traffic patterns is paramount; noticing consistent gaps and anticipating the movements of vehicles is key to efficient navigation. Avoiding overly aggressive plays and prioritizing survival over maximizing points in the early stages can build momentum. Learning the timing of the vehicles and the chicken's movement speed is crucial. Focusing on small, calculated movements is preferable to large, risky leaps. Remembering that patience is a virtue – sometimes, waiting for the perfect opportunity is better than rushing into a potentially fatal situation.

Furthermore, many games introduce power-ups or special abilities that can aid in the chicken’s journey. These might include temporary invincibility, speed boosts, or the ability to slow down time. Utilizing these power-ups strategically can significantly increase a player’s score, but it’s important to save them for moments when they are most needed. Mastering these strategic elements will undoubtedly enhance your experience.
